They're Gas Safe registered
Gas Safe registration is a guarantee that the top gas boiler engineers have the qualifications and experience to perform their work safely. Gas Safe Register registration is required to work on gas appliances. About 60 carbon monoxide poisonings occur every year in England and Wales.
Unregistered engineers can have grave consequences. They could cause damage to your heating system and lead to expensive repairs. It is important to locate a professional and licensed gas engineer registered on the Gas Safe Register.
You can verify an engineer's registration by texting Gas and the engineer's licence number of seven digits to the number 85080. If you're concerned about an engineer's status, you can also request a picture of their licence from the text service.

In the course of a boiler maintenance technician will conduct a series tests to ensure that your boiler is running safely and correctly. They'll also examine your gas supply to ensure that it's not leaking carbon monoxide or other harmful gases. Additionally, they'll make sure that your boiler doesn't leak any water and that all components are operating properly.
A faulty ignition is a common problem which can prevent your boiler producing any heat. This part ignites the fuel (oil or gas) in the combustion chamber. If it's damaged the boiler won't start. The replacement of the ignitor can be a fairly inexpensive fix.

They're qualified
A gas boiler engineer is a professional who works on the installation, repair, and servicing of gas-powered heating appliances and heating systems. They are skilled to deal with everything from water heaters to gas cookers, radiators and central heating systems. They are also able to recognize problems and recommend the most effective solutions for their customers. Some gas engineers choose to work on their own, while others are employed by heating or plumbing companies. The career of a gas engineer starts by completing a stage three gas engineer boiler certificate in a college or an apprenticeship. After completing the level 3 gas engineer boiler qualification, the gas engineer must pass the ACS tests to be accepted onto the Gas Safety Register. Additional qualifications are available to specialize in a certain area.

The cost of the service required for a gas boiler can vary based on its nature and the complexity. Installing a new boiler is more expensive than repairing a current one. Additionally, after-hours or emergency services will have an additional cost. Other costs include travel and equipment. These costs will depend on the distance between your residence and the engineer's base, and could be added to the final bill.
Certain gas engineers provide fixed-price repairs, meaning that you'll know the total price before they begin working on your system. These rates are typically less expensive than hourly rates. Some companies charge per project, which is more expensive than fixed-price repairs. The cost of a boiler service depends on a variety of aspects, including where you live and how complex the job is. Heating and gas engineers usually charges an hourly fee that ranges from PS40 and PS70. They might charge more if they are called out in an emergency, or if the work is more complex. Additional fees can be charged for equipment removal and upgrading of ventilation lines or gas lines.

The heat exchanger in a boiler is responsible for transfer of heat throughout the house. The exchanger may crack and lead to water leakage from the boiler. This issue should be addressed immediately as it could cause major damage if not dealt with.
There are many factors that can lead to a leaking boiler, including high pressure or a lot of thermal stress. If the issue isn't dealt with promptly, it could cause serious issues such as flooding and mold. If the leak is the result of corrosion, it's crucial to have it repaired by a professional.
